A native of Richmond, Virginia and a product of Howard University, Kia made her introduction into entertainment while singing with former Washington D.C. group "Entyme" along with other respected soul artists Geno Young, Sy Smith, and Yahzarah. Kia is a member of the new school RAMP (Roy Ayers Music Production) whose musical contributions provided the world with samples for hits like A Tribe Called Quest's "Bonita Applebum", Mary J. Blige's "My Life" and Erykah Badu's "Amerykah's Promise". Ms. Bennett is best noted for her background vocals, which supported international recording artists Roy Ayers, D'Angelo, Ledisi, Michael Bolton, and others. She is also formerly half of the singing duo, Kia Bennett & Desiree Jordan as KiDe’. Kia recently reached a new career milestone at the 68th Annual Grammy Awards. She contributed her vocal talents to the track “Tuesday’s Thoughts” on Mad Skillz’s “Words For Days, Volume 1,” which took home the Grammy for Best Spoken Word and Poetry Album. Kia has also acted in thirteen movies/series on Netflix, BET+, Showtime, AppleTV, Hulu, and theaters, including Harriet, The Good Lord Bird, and Dopesick.
Kia's dynamic band - Control the Room - features: Trevelle Harris (drums); Trevon Jones (bass); Aaron Booker (guitar); Anthony Lyons (keys); and Talton Manning (sax).
